======= FEZ1 ======= == Gene Information == * **Official Symbol**: FEZ1 * **Official Name**: fasciculation and elongation protein zeta 1 * **Aliases and Previous Symbols**: N/A * **Entrez ID**: [[https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/gene/?term=9638|9638]] * **UniProt**: [[https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/Q99689|Q99689]] * **Interactions**: [[https://thebiogrid.org/search.php?search=FEZ1&organism=9606|BioGRID]] * **PubMed articles**: [[https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/?term=gene%20FEZ1|Open PubMed]] * **OMIM**: [[https://omim.org/entry/604825|Open OMIM]] == Function Summary == * **Entrez Summary**: N/A * **UniProt Summary**: May be involved in axonal outgrowth as component of the network of molecules that regulate cellular morphology and axon guidance machinery. Able to restore partial locomotion and axonal fasciculation to C.elegans unc-76 mutants in germline transformation experiments.
